𝑼𝒏𝒍𝒆𝒂𝒔𝒉𝒊𝒏𝒈 𝒕𝒉𝒆 𝑮𝒆𝒏 𝑨𝑰 𝑰𝒎𝒑𝒂𝒄𝒕: 𝑴𝒂𝒏𝒖𝒇𝒂𝒄𝒕𝒖𝒓𝒊𝒏𝒈 𝑰𝒏𝒅𝒖𝒔𝒕𝒓𝒚 𝑻𝒓𝒂𝒏𝒔𝒇𝒐𝒓𝒎𝒂𝒕𝒊𝒐𝒏 𝒂𝒏𝒅 𝑭𝒖𝒕𝒖𝒓𝒆 𝑷𝒓𝒐𝒔𝒑𝒆𝒄𝒕𝒔
Over the past few years, the adoption of Artificial Intelligence (AI) within the manufacturing sector has revolutionized conventional procedures, leading to heightened efficiency, accuracy, and ingenuity. Among the various AI advancements, Generative AI stands out as especially influential, offering distinctive benefits to manufacturing. This article delves into the numerous advantages of integrating Generative AI into manufacturing processes, illuminating its transformative role within the industry.
Here's how it's affecting the manufacturing industry and what the future outlook might be:
𝘼𝙪𝙩𝙤𝙢𝙖𝙩𝙞𝙤𝙣 𝙖𝙣𝙙 𝙀𝙛𝙛𝙞𝙘𝙞𝙚𝙣𝙘𝙮 : Gen AI technologies, such as machine learning algorithms and robotics, are revolutionizing manufacturing processes. Automation is becoming more intelligent and adaptable, leading to increased efficiency in production lines. Tasks that were once manual and time-consuming can now be automated, reducing costs and improving productivity.
𝙀𝙣𝙝𝙖𝙣𝙘𝙚𝙙 𝘿𝙚𝙨𝙞𝙜𝙣 𝙊𝙥𝙩𝙞𝙢𝙞𝙯𝙖𝙩𝙞𝙤𝙣: Generative AI in manufacturing enables engineers to enhance designs with unparalleled efficiency. Through the analysis of extensive datasets and the consideration of various design factors, AI algorithms produce innovative and optimized designs tailored to specific requirements, resulting in more durable and resource-efficient products.
𝙋𝙧𝙚𝙙𝙞𝙘𝙩𝙞𝙫𝙚 𝙈𝙖𝙞𝙣𝙩𝙚𝙣𝙖𝙣𝙘𝙚: AI-powered analytics enable predictive maintenance in manufacturing plants. By analyzing data from sensors and machinery, AI can predict when equipment is likely to fail and schedule maintenance proactively. This minimizes downtime and prevents costly breakdowns, optimizing the overall performance of manufacturing operations.
𝙌𝙪𝙖𝙡𝙞𝙩𝙮 𝘾𝙤𝙣𝙩𝙧𝙤𝙡: AI systems can inspect products with incredible accuracy, detecting defects that may be imperceptible to the human eye. Through computer vision and image recognition, AI algorithms can identify deviations from quality standards in real-time, ensuring that only high-quality products reach the market. This leads to improved customer satisfaction and reduced waste.
𝙎𝙪𝙥𝙥𝙡𝙮 𝘾𝙝𝙖𝙞𝙣 𝙊𝙥𝙩𝙞𝙢𝙞𝙯𝙖𝙩𝙞𝙤𝙣: Gen AI is transforming supply chain management in manufacturing. AI algorithms can analyze vast amounts of data to optimize inventory levels, streamline logistics, and enhance demand forecasting. By making supply chains more responsive and adaptive, manufacturers can reduce costs, minimize lead times, and improve overall efficiency.
𝙋𝙚𝙧𝙨𝙤𝙣𝙖𝙡𝙞𝙯𝙚𝙙 𝙈𝙖𝙣𝙪𝙛𝙖𝙘𝙩𝙪𝙧𝙞𝙣𝙜: AI technologies enable mass customization and personalized manufacturing at scale. By leveraging data on customer preferences and market trends, manufacturers can tailor products to individual needs and preferences. This customization enhances customer satisfaction and creates opportunities for new revenue streams.
𝙒𝙤𝙧𝙠𝙛𝙤𝙧𝙘𝙚 𝘼𝙪𝙜𝙢𝙚𝙣𝙩𝙖𝙩𝙞𝙤𝙣: Rather than replacing human workers, AI is augmenting their capabilities in the manufacturing industry. Collaborative robots (CoBots) work alongside humans, assisting with repetitive or dangerous tasks and improving overall safety in the workplace. AI-powered tools also enhance decision-making by providing workers with real-time insights and recommendations.
𝙀𝙣𝙝𝙖𝙣𝙘𝙚𝙙 𝘿𝙚𝙘𝙞𝙨𝙞𝙤𝙣-𝙈𝙖𝙠𝙞𝙣𝙜: Generative AI leverages extensive data processing and analysis to offer valuable insights. This aids decision-makers in making informed, data-driven choices, thereby enhancing the effectiveness and strategic nature of decision-making within manufacturing.
𝙎𝙪𝙨𝙩𝙖𝙞𝙣𝙖𝙗𝙞𝙡𝙞𝙩𝙮: Gen AI is driving sustainability initiatives in manufacturing. AI algorithms can optimize energy usage, minimize waste, and reduce environmental impact across the production process. By adopting AI-driven sustainability practices, manufacturers can meet regulatory requirements, enhance brand reputation, and contribute to a more sustainable future.
𝘾𝙤𝙢𝙥𝙚𝙩𝙞𝙩𝙞𝙫𝙚 𝘼𝙙𝙫𝙖𝙣𝙩𝙖𝙜𝙚: Adopting Generative AI into manufacturing places companies at the forefront of technological innovation. By maintaining a leading position, businesses secure a competitive edge, appealing to customers and partners who prioritize efficiency, quality, and sustainability.
Overall, the future outlook for the manufacturing industry with Gen AI is one of increased efficiency, agility, and innovation. Companies that embrace AI technologies stand to gain a competitive advantage by optimizing their operations, improving product quality, and delivering greater value to customers. However, they must also address challenges related to data privacy, cybersecurity, and workforce reskilling to fully realize the potential benefits of AI in manufacturing.
